I'd like to remind our veterans and inform all of our new members that I don't charge your credit card until one week prior to the tournament. After registration you may withdraw/cancel without charge until midnight 7 days before the tournament. Don't forget about the Blackwolf Run major May 19-20. It will sell out soon.
